From 78584cf2bd73bfb853141eb80fc9e07b8610a896 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001
From: Elliott Hughes <[email protected]>
Date: Mon, 10 Jun 2019 12:38:43 -0700
Subject: [PATCH] find: add -true/-false.

Used near the end of the AOSP build. Almost there!

(This patch also fiddles with the help text to be able to slip the new
options in without requiring so much extra space.)
---
 tests/find.test   |  3 +++
 toys/posix/find.c | 43 ++++++++++++++++++++++++-------------------
 2 files changed, 27 insertions(+), 19 deletions(-)

diff --git a/tests/find.test b/tests/find.test
index 26ad1626..ab84fb07 100755
--- a/tests/find.test
+++ b/tests/find.test
@@ -105,4 +105,7 @@ testing "-printf" "find dir -name file -printf '%f %p %P %s'" \
 testing "-printf .N" "find dir -name file -printf %.2f" "fi" "" ""
 
 
+testing "-false" "find dir -false" "" "" ""
+testing "-true" "find dir/file -true" "dir/file\n" "" ""
+
 rm -rf dir
diff --git a/toys/posix/find.c b/toys/posix/find.c
index fe712c88..5fc9b0ce 100644
--- a/toys/posix/find.c
+++ b/toys/posix/find.c
@@ -17,24 +17,25 @@ config FIND
     usage: find [-HL] [DIR...] [<options>]
 
     Search directories for matching files.
-    Default: search "." match all -print all matches.
+    Default: search ".", match all, -print matches.
 
     -H  Follow command line symlinks         -L  Follow all symlinks
 
     Match filters:
-    -name  PATTERN  filename with wildcards   -iname      case insensitive -name
-    -path  PATTERN  path name with wildcards  -ipath      case insensitive -path
-    -user  UNAME    belongs to user UNAME     -nouser     user ID not known
-    -group GROUP    belongs to group GROUP    -nogroup    group ID not known
-    -perm  [-/]MODE permissions (-=min /=any) -prune      ignore contents of dir
-    -size  N[c]     512 byte blocks (c=bytes) -xdev       only this filesystem
-    -links N        hardlink count            -atime N[u] accessed N units ago
-    -ctime N[u]     created N units ago       -mtime N[u] modified N units ago
-    -newer FILE     newer mtime than FILE     -mindepth # at least # dirs down
-    -depth          ignore contents of dir    -maxdepth # at most # dirs down
-    -inum  N        inode number N            -empty      empty files and dirs
-    -type [bcdflps]   (block, char, dir, file, symlink, pipe, socket)
-    -context PATTERN  security context
+    -name  PATTERN   filename with wildcards  (-iname case insensitive)
+    -path  PATTERN   path name with wildcards (-ipath case insensitive)
+    -user  UNAME     belongs to user UNAME     -nouser     user ID not known
+    -group GROUP     belongs to group GROUP    -nogroup    group ID not known
+    -perm  [-/]MODE  permissions (-=min /=any) -prune      ignore dir contents
+    -size  N[c]      512 byte blocks (c=bytes) -xdev       only this filesystem
+    -links N         hardlink count            -atime N[u] accessed N units ago
+    -ctime N[u]      created N units ago       -mtime N[u] modified N units ago
+    -newer FILE      newer mtime than FILE     -mindepth N at least N dirs down
+    -depth           ignore contents of dir    -maxdepth N at most N dirs down
+    -inum N          inode number N            -empty      empty files and dirs
+    -type [bcdflps]  type is (block, char, dir, file, symlink, pipe, socket)
+    -true            always true               -false      always false
+    -context PATTERN security context
 
     Numbers N may be prefixed by a - (less than) or + (greater than). Units for
     -Xtime are d (days, default), h (hours), m (minutes), or s (seconds).
@@ -43,11 +44,10 @@ config FIND
     !, -a, -o, ( )    not, and, or, group expressions
 
     Actions:
-    -print   Print match with newline  -print0    Print match with null
-    -exec    Run command with path     -execdir   Run command in file's dir
-    -ok      Ask before exec           -okdir     Ask before execdir
-    -delete         Remove matching file/dir
-    -printf FORMAT  Print using format string
+    -print  Print match with newline  -print0        Print match with null
+    -exec   Run command with path     -execdir       Run command in file's dir
+    -ok     Ask before exec           -okdir         Ask before execdir
+    -delete Remove matching file/dir  -printf FORMAT Print using format string
 
     Commands substitute "{}" with matched file. End with ";" to run each file,
     or "+" (next argument after "{}") to collect and run with multiple files.
@@ -305,6 +305,11 @@ static int do_find(struct dirtree *new)
     } else if (!strcmp(s, "not")) {
       if (check) not = !not;
       continue;
+    } else if (!strcmp(s, "true")) {
+      if (check) test = 1;
+    } else if (!strcmp(s, "false")) {
+      if (check) test = 0;
+
     // Mostly ignore NOP argument
     } else if (!strcmp(s, "a") || !strcmp(s, "and") || !strcmp(s, "noleaf")) {
       if (not) goto error;
